Loaded Gun, The (1958)
The film discusses the dangers of driving with faulty tires, comparing them to a loaded gun. It highlights that many accidents are caused by mechanical failures, particularly tire defects, which can occur even with new tires. The film emphasizes the importance of tire strength and safety, showcasing the superior features of General’s Dual 90 tires. It stresses that the automobile poses significant risks, likening it to a weapon, and urges viewers to prioritize tire safety to prevent accidents.
